如何有效解决宝塔面板数据库管理密码错误问题?

请检查并确认您输入的密码是否正确,或者尝试重置密码。如果问题仍然存在,请联系宝塔官方客服寻求帮助。
宝塔面板是一款非常流行的服务器管理软件,它提供了便捷的网站、数据库和FTP等管理功能,在使用过程中可能会遇到数据库管理密码错误的问题,本文将详细介绍如何解决这一问题。

如何有效解决宝塔面板数据库管理密码错误问题?

问题原因分析

在解决密码错误问题之前,首先要了解可能导致该问题的原因:

1、忘记或记错密码:最常见的原因是用户忘记了自己设置的密码或者输入时出现错误。

2、密码规则限制宝塔面板对数据库密码有特定的安全要求,如必须包含大小写字母、数字及特殊字符等。

3、权限不足:当前登录的用户可能没有足够的权限去修改或重置密码。

4、软件Bug或兼容性问题:极少数情况下,可能是由于宝塔面板本身的软件缺陷或与服务器环境的不兼容导致。

5、网络延迟或故障:在进行远程操作时,网络不稳定可能导致操作超时或响应失败。

6、缓存问题:浏览器或系统的缓存有时会导致旧的登录信息被重复提交。

7、第三方插件冲突:安装的某些安全插件或优化工具可能会影响正常的登录流程。

解决方法

方法一:通过宝塔面板重置密码

1、登录宝塔面板:使用管理员账户登录到宝塔面板。

2、进入数据库管理界面:点击左侧菜单中的“数据库”选项。

3、选择目标数据库:在数据库列表中找到需要重置密码的数据库。

4、执行SQL命令:点击“管理”按钮,然后选择“SQL”选项卡,输入以下SQL命令来重置密码(以MySQL为例):

   ALTER USER 'username'@'localhost' IDENTIFIED BY 'new_password';

username是数据库用户名,new_password是新的密码。

如何有效解决宝塔面板数据库管理密码错误问题?

5、提交更改:点击“执行”按钮,完成密码重置。

方法二:使用命令行工具重置密码

1、登录服务器:通过SSH客户端(如PuTTY)登录到服务器。

2、停止数据库服务:根据使用的数据库类型,执行相应的停止命令,例如对于MySQL:

   sudo systemctl stop mysqld

3、跳过权限表启动数据库:以安全模式启动数据库,跳过权限检查:

   sudo mysqld_safe --skip-grant-tables &

4、登录数据库:使用root用户登录数据库:

   mysql -u root

5、重置密码:执行以下命令来重置密码(以MySQL为例):

   FLUSH PRIVILEGES;
   ALTER USER 'username'@'localhost' IDENTIFIED BY 'new_password';

6、重启数据库服务:退出数据库后,重启数据库服务:

   sudo systemctl restart mysqld

方法三:联系客服支持

如果以上方法都无法解决问题,可以联系宝塔官方客服寻求帮助,准备好相关的服务器信息和问题描述,以便客服更快地定位问题并提供解决方案。

预防措施

为了避免未来再次遇到类似问题,可以采取以下预防措施:

1、定期更换密码:定期更新数据库密码,并确保新密码符合安全标准。

2、记录重要信息:将重要的密码信息记录在安全的地方,如密码管理器中。

3、设置复杂密码:使用包含大小写字母、数字及特殊字符的复杂密码。

如何有效解决宝塔面板数据库管理密码错误问题?

4、备份数据:定期备份数据库数据,以防万一需要恢复。

5、监控日志:定期检查服务器和数据库的日志文件,以便及时发现异常情况。

6、更新软件版本:保持宝塔面板及其组件的最新状态,以获得最新的功能和安全修复。

7、限制登录尝试:配置防火墙规则或使用fail2ban等工具限制非法登录尝试的次数。

8、使用SSL/TLS加密:为数据库连接启用SSL/TLS加密,以提高数据传输的安全性。

9、教育用户:对使用宝塔面板的用户进行安全意识培训,让他们了解如何正确管理和保护敏感信息。

10、审计和合规性检查:定期进行安全审计和合规性检查,确保系统符合行业标准和法规要求。

相关问题与解答

Q1: 如果忘记宝塔面板的管理密码怎么办?

A1: 如果忘记了宝塔面板的管理密码,可以尝试以下步骤找回或重置密码:检查是否设置了邮箱找回功能,如果有,可以通过邮箱验证来重置密码;如果没有设置邮箱找回,可以尝试联系宝塔官方客服,提供相关的注册信息和身份验证后,由客服协助重置密码;如果以上方法都不可行,可能需要重新安装宝塔面板来重置所有设置。

Q2: 如何增强宝塔面板的安全性?

A2: 为了增强宝塔面板的安全性,可以采取以下措施:定期更新宝塔面板及其插件到最新版本,以获取最新的安全补丁;使用强密码策略,确保所有账户都使用复杂且唯一的密码;限制IP地址访问,只允许可信任的IP地址能够访问宝塔面板;启用两步验证(如谷歌身份验证器),增加额外的登录安全层;定期备份网站和数据库数据,以防止数据丢失或被篡改。

小伙伴们,上文介绍了“宝塔面板数据库管理密码错误的解决方法”的内容,你了解清楚吗?希望对你有所帮助,任何问题可以给我留言,让我们下期再见吧。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1192042.html

(0)
未希的头像未希新媒体运营
上一篇 2024-10-09 12:34
下一篇 2024-10-09 12:35

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

免费注册
电话联系

400-880-8834

产品咨询
产品咨询
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购  >>点击进入